Pirelli confident in 2017 tyres despite no hot weather testing
Pirelli are confident in their new tyres for the 2017 season, despite not being able to test their new rubber in hot weather conditions. “We’re pretty confident that we’ve made a good step and we believe it’s going to be a very interesting year for the history of Formula One,” Pirelli’s Motorsport Director Paul Hembery told Formula Spy at the Autosport Show. Hot weather testing in Bahrain was considered an appropriate trial for the new rubber, but teams wanted to keep the entirety of pre-season testing in Barcelona to cut costs; which Hembery still believes is not the correct decision. “I understand the reason why the majority of teams didn’t want to go [to Bahrain]....
